Output 4c66bb339e58c7e33c42720ae90d78954059831d668b8afc1f45e07427a17659:2

value
1096426928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b38b0714d84f98300255eae88e7f79f8cebbb79 OP_EQUAL
address
MAP6PSqYsZX7dsZPiT6RNL7McE5eCmSHFG
transaction
4c66bb339e58c7e33c42720ae90d78954059831d668b8afc1f45e07427a17659
spent
true